The Essence of 5 Person Yoga

Understanding the Basics

Before we dive into the intricacies of 5 person yoga, let’s establish a foundational understanding of what it entails. Unlike traditional yoga, which often focuses on individual practice, 5 person yoga involves a group of five individuals coming together to perform synchronized poses. This form of yoga places a strong emphasis on communication, trust, and unity among participants.

A Journey Through 5 Person Yoga Poses

Now that we have laid the groundwork, let’s explore some exhilarating 5 person yoga poses that will not only challenge your physical prowess but also deepen the connection with your fellow yogis.

1. Circle of Trust Pose

Form a circle with all participants facing each other.

Join hands to create a strong, interconnected circle.

Slowly lean back, trusting your fellow participants to support your weight.

Find balance and hold the pose, creating a sense of trust and unity.

2. Pyramid Pose Relay

Stand in a line with each participant facing the same direction.

The first person bends forward into a pyramid pose, placing their hands on the ground.

The second person does the same, placing their hands on the first person’s hips.

Continue the relay, creating a pyramid of interconnected bodies.

3. Partner Tree Pose Fusion

Pair up with a fellow yogi, facing each other.

Both participants lift one leg, resting the sole of their foot against the inner thigh of their partner.

Join hands in a prayer position, finding balance together.

Embrace the shared energy and focus on the connection between partners.
